From b0a7efb5a959a6105486d303d25d06d69d5d569e Mon Sep 17 00:00:00 2001 From: Jeff Hartmann Date: Thu, 28 Sep 2000 23:04:57 +0000 Subject: [PATCH] Use PG_reserved for things we remap non-cached --- linux/mga_dma.c |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/linux/mga_dma.c b/linux/mga_dma.c index 40d77160..9f12a2be 100644 --- a/linux/mga_dma.c +++ b/linux/mga_dma.c @@ -58,7 +58,7 @@ static unsigned long mga_alloc_page(drm_device_t *dev) return 0; } atomic_inc(&virt_to_page(address)->count); - set_bit(PG_locked, &virt_to_page(address)->flags); + set_bit(PG_reserved, &virt_to_page(address)->flags); return address; } @@ -67,8 +67,7 @@ static void mga_free_page(drm_device_t *dev, unsigned long page) { if(!page) return; atomic_dec(&virt_to_page(page)->count); - clear_bit(PG_locked, &virt_to_page(page)->flags); - wake_up(&virt_to_page(page)->wait); + clear_bit(PG_reserved, &virt_to_page(page)->flags); free_page(page); return; }